HI,
I've planted spuds as a first timer this year and hey presto they grew. Now that it's time to lift them I need advice on how to store them. Any suggestions?
Thank You.
Hi Tribesman06.
Hope this information will be of help.
You need a timber box or crate.(any size) even a tomato crate will do.
Line the bottom with newspaper . put layer of sand approx. 1/4 inch then put a layer of spuds on top.Cover with sand now a layer of newspaper 3 to 4 sheets thick. Then repeat unitl box is full. one layer at a time only. this can be stored anywhere.
Do not wash spuds. Any clean sand will do.
Spuds should last till next season.
This is the old way of storing spuds.
